Toyota HSD concept

Fri, 18 Mar 2011

The Yaris HSD, as presented in Geneva, previews Toyota's intentions of bringing Hybrid technology to the B-Segment, as well as Toyota's full hybrid roll out across all models in its range. Retaining the familiar Yaris outwardly appearance (and previewing the next generation Yaris) the HSD is interspersed with ‘Hybrid' cues, to intimate at the hybrid powertrain beneath the body. From the pearl white paint to the light blue hue that illuminates certain aspects, there is an underlying emphasis on the fact that this car is a hybrid.

Ready-to-race Ford Focus ST-R walk-around: Video

Thu, 22 Dec 2011

The folks at Ford released a video Christmas present this week featuring Ford Racing's Andy Vrenko hosting a complete walk-around of the company's latest turn-key race car, the Ford Focus ST-R. The latest spec racer is approved for competition in the Grand-Am ST, World Challenge TC and the Canadian Touring Car series (pending homologation approvals). The engine and transmission are production-based components from the street-legal Focus ST.

2014 Ram 1500 diesel in the works

Thu, 14 Feb 2013

Chrysler has announced that a diesel-powered Ram 1500 pickup is in the works. It's expected to hit dealer lots -- and presumably, America's family farms -- in the third quarter of 2013. Set to be released as a 2014 model year vehicle, the oil-burning 1500 will get a 3.0-liter V6 wearing Chrysler's new EcoDiesel branding.
